Laminatid Chipboard

Laminated particle board (Laminated chipboard) - is grinded chipboard, which by means of physico-chemical processes covered paper-resin films. The process of making chipboard effected by temperature (140 ° - 210 ° C) and pressure (25 028 MPa). In this process, decorative-протеctive layer on the plate of laminated chipboard is formed by spreading on the surface of the resin plate with followed hardening andn forming coverage.
